汉诺塔4层详细步骤

作者&投稿:言斧 (若有异议请与网页底部的电邮联系)

汉诺塔该怎么玩,方法
汉诺塔算法介绍:一位美国学者发现的特别简单的方法:只要轮流用两次如下方法就可以了。把三根柱子按顺序排成“品”字型,把所有圆盘按从大到小的顺序放于柱子A上,根据圆盘数量来确定柱子排放的顺序:n若为偶数的话,顺时针方向依次摆放为:ABC;而n若为奇数的话,就按顺时针方向依次摆放为:ACB。这...

悬空图怎么开?
任务过程:去找位于赫顿玛尔的神枪手导师——凯丽谈话 任务报酬:300金币 任务备注:需要完成【没有修复的魔法阵】任务后 任务名:存在的悬空城 任务过程:4人组队通关一次天空之海·浅海王者级别 任务报酬:金块、黑曜石 任务备注:需要完成【变强的天空之城气息】任务后 任务名:悬空城--第一个关口 ...

魔兽世界帐号如何更改身份证、资料、战网通行证
1、没有进行身份证认证的。2、身份证验证失败的,也就是说你注册登记的信息中,姓名和身份证号对不上的,这种情况会验证失败,你才可以更改。战网通行证是注册默认的,无法更改。

惠敬13540556539问: 汉诺塔4的时候怎么整 -
秀城区希路回答: 1 把 1-3 搬到 第二塔 2 把 4 搬到第三塔3 把 1-3 搬到第三塔.至于 怎么把 1-3 搬到第二塔 , 其实就是 1-2-->三 3-->二 1-2 -->二 这就是递归最常见的例子.

惠敬13540556539问: 汉诺塔问题的递归算法流程图 -
秀城区希路回答: 关键是第一步移法,奇数层的说,3层在第一柱,后两根柱数数:123.所以,第一块应放在第二根柱,4层,第一块放第三柱............奇数层第一块放第二柱,偶数层第一块放第三柱.

惠敬13540556539问: 谁能告诉我关于汉诺塔递归算法的详细运行步骤(c\c++)? -
秀城区希路回答: 汉诺塔的规则是把N个盘子从A柱挪到C柱(假设是这样) 那末,我们要做的就是把N-1个盘子从A柱挪到B柱,再把1个盘子从A柱挪到C柱,再把N-1个盘子从B柱挪到C柱. 当运行到N-1的时候,N就代表N-1,这时再把N-2个盘子从开始柱挪到临时柱,再把1个主子从开始柱挪到结束柱,再把n-2个柱子从临时柱挪到结束柱.不停的调用自身,直到调用的程序的N=1的时候…… 说了这些,不知道阁下懂不懂.

惠敬13540556539问: C语言 -- 汉诺塔程序执行步骤 -
秀城区希路回答: 这个问题你要先把递归搞懂才能理解的, 最好是单跟踪执行一下, 我这里就简单说一下吧!hanoi(5, 'a', 'b', 'c');把5个从'a'移到'c' 这时n=5, noe='a', two='b', three='c' 因为n!=1, 执行else里的 hanoi( 4, 'a', 'c', 'b'); //把上面4个从a移到b ...

惠敬13540556539问: 5层汉诺塔游戏31步怎么移到另一个柱子上? -
秀城区希路回答: 5层汉诺来塔游戏弄好四层后,先把上面的四个借助第三根柱子移到第二根柱子上,再把剩下的一个移到第三根柱源子上,最后借助第一根柱子将第二根柱子上的移到第三根柱子上去.1. 汉诺塔,又称河内塔,是一款WP7平台上源于印度一个古老传说的益智类游戏. 2. 汉诺塔:传说上帝创造世界的时候做了三根金刚石柱子,在一根柱子上从下往上安大小顺序摞着64片黄金圆盘.上帝命令婆罗门把圆盘从下面开始按大小顺序重新摆放在另一根柱子上.并且规定,在小圆盘上不能放大圆盘,在三根柱子之间一次只能移动一个圆盘.

惠敬13540556539问: 史上最难智力游戏第五关汉诺塔怎么过 -
秀城区希路回答: 通关步骤: 1.如下图所示:柱子从左到右设为:ABC ;环从小到大设为:12345; 2.移动方法: 1→C,2→B,1→B,3→C,1→A,2→C,1→C,4→B; 1→B,2→A,1→A,3→B,1→C,2→B,1→B,5→C; 1→A,2→C,1→C,4→A,1→B,2→A,1→A,4→C; 1→C,2→B,1→B,3→C,1→A,2→C,1→C,完成!

惠敬13540556539问: 汉诺塔问题公式是什么? -
秀城区希路回答: 汉诺塔问题(又称河内塔问题)是根据一个传说形成的一个问题:有三根杆子A,B,C.A杆上有N个(N>1)穿孔圆盘,盘的尺寸由下到上依次变小.要求按下列规则将所有圆盘移至C杆:1. 每次只能移动一个圆盘; 2. 大盘不能叠在小盘上面. ...

惠敬13540556539问: 求C汉诺塔递归过程详解 -
秀城区希路回答: 解决汉诺塔的基本思想是先把n个盘子除了最下面的盘子以外的所有盘子从第一根柱子(初始柱子)移动到中间那个柱子上(辅助柱子),然后把最下面的盘子移动到最后一根柱子上(目标柱子).最后把剩下的盘子移动到目标柱子上.这样,...

惠敬13540556539问: 汉诺塔3个盘子时很容易移,但是4个盘子时怎么移呢?可以把步骤写给我吗?我都想崩溃了. -
秀城区希路回答: 我可以玩通关.塔用1234 柱子用ABC4层:1-B 2-C 1-C 3-B 1-A 2-B 1-B 4-C 1-C 2-A 1-A 3-C 1-B 2-C 1-C

惠敬13540556539问: 汉诺塔n=4(4个盘)c语言递归编程代码 -
秀城区希路回答: /**************************** 汉诺塔的算法就3个步骤:第一,把a上的n-1个盘通过c移动到b.第二,把a上的最下面的盘移到c.a成了空的.第三,因为n-1个盘全在b上了,所以把b当做a.重复以上步骤就好了.所以算法看起来就简单多了.*********...


本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 星空见康网